
Over 5,000 policemen to ensure public order in Moldova on 26-28 August
Chisinau, 26 August /MOLDPRES/ - Over 5,000 policemen will ensure the public order in Moldova’s settlements on 26-28 August, in the context of the marking of the 30th anniversary of Moldova’s Independence on 27 August and the Assumption of the Mother of God on 28 August. To avoid the discomfort created by the traffic’s restriction and imposing of the measures triggered by the pandemic, the General Police Inspectorate (IGP) called on the residents to prove understanding and cooperation.
“On 26-28 August, tens of public events will be held in the country on the occasion of the Independence day and the dedication day holiday, due in about 100 settlements. Most festivities are planned in the capital, where three heads of state, many guests, official delegations are expected and a military parade will take place. We call on the people to prove understanding and cooperate with policemen, who will ensure the public order, in conditions when more transport routes are redirected, parking is banned in more districts and enhanced guard,’’ an IGP representative, Alexei Grosu, said at a today’s news briefing.
At the same time, the General Police Inspectorate called on the citizens not to forget that we are in pandemic crisis and avoid, as far as possible, crowded places, observing the sanitary and epidemiological rules.
